Description
Editions des Chroniques du Jour, Paris 1930. One of 550 numbered copies of the French edition (total edition 1200 copies). Translated by De Francisco Amunategui. With four color pochoir by Picasso: Jeune homme et enfant 1906, Femme Assise 194, Les Musiciens 1921, Le Fils de l' Artiste 1925 and numerous illustrations in black and white, in full page. Text in French. Well preserved in the original orange cover and matching hard chemise with laces. The portfolio folder shows some wear, most notably along the spine, which exhibits several tears — including a larger split of approximately four inches at the lower section and a smaller tear at the top. The internal binding shows some separation in places but remains intact. The pochoirs are in very good condition overall, with only one sheet showing a faint smudge in the upper right margin.

Description
Cádiz: Revista Médica, 1847. First edition. Hardcover. Very good. 12mo. 224pp. followed by 29pp of appendices. Contemporary quarter leather, spine gilt, marbled ans embossed paper over boards, marbled endpapers and edges. Inner hinge and spine neatly mended, edges worn, else this is a very good copy. The scarce first printing of Castro's groundbreaking History of the Jews in Spain. A member of the Royal Academy, he was so impartial that he felt a need to remark on page 8: "Escribo esta historia sin pasion, ni artificio, como de cosas que nada me tocan. Ni soi judio, ni vengo de judaizantes" (I write this history dispassionately and without craft, as concerning things that do not touch me. I am not a Jew, nor am I of Jewish descent.) Unlike others who followed him, he condemned the Inquisition. His HIstory was translated into English in 1851 by Rev. Edward Kirwan, Cambridge. In Spanish. .

Description
nd. Hardcover. VG- (Some copies may be difficult to read.). Loose leaves filed in three-ringed blue plastic notebook. Appx. 70-90 sheets of paper, some of which are not easy to read. Copies of notes, correspondence, assembled chronologies, and a log of contact information assembled by an unknown source, in an effort to research the life and work of American artist Thomas H. Hope (1832-1926). Includes references to his possible connections to George F. Bensell (1837-1879) and William Michael Harnett (1848-1892). This notebook was assembled by Spanierman Galleries as part of an ongoing research project.
